138 messaggi dal 23 settembre 2003
uso sql server (non ricordo la versione perchè ora sono a casa, comunque è recente)

apporto le modfiche alle mie tablelle dall'enterprise manager in maniera visuale; avrei però bisogno di salvare anche il codice sql

esempio:
"

ALTER TABLE Test ADD TestColumn INT NOT NULL..ecc.

"
in modo da poterla applicare al DB in produzione; ho provato un'opzione ma mi salva un file sql enorme che non penso mi tornerebbe utile, a me basta l'alter (ricordo che su Oracle si può ad esempio)


qualcuno sa come aiutarmi?

grazie
2.410 messaggi dal 13 febbraio 2003
Contributi
puoi usare SSMS di SQL Server 2005 che ti salva tutte le operazioni in codice TSQL oppure usare SQL Compare di Red-Gate (a pagamento)
138 messaggi dal 23 settembre 2003
ora non ho sottomano sql server ma è difficile attivare questo SSMS?

garzie
2.410 messaggi dal 13 febbraio 2003
Contributi
SSMS è il sostituto di Enterprise Manager per MSSQL 2005 pertanto se usi MSSQL 2005 lo trovi sotto Start -> Tutti i programmi -> Microsoft SQL Server 2005 -> SQL Server Management Studio (SSMS per gli amici :D)
138 messaggi dal 23 settembre 2003
io ho SQL Server 2000, non posso quindi?

grazie
1.976 messaggi dal 27 luglio 2005
Contributi
salve,
clockdva ha scritto:
io ho SQL Server 2000, non posso quindi?

grazie


potresti utilizzare SQL Server Management Studio Express, liberamente scaricabile da http://www.microsoft.com/downloads/details.aspx?displaylang=en&FamilyID=6053c6f8-82c8-479c-b25b-9aca13141c9e... personalmente pero' non te lo consiglio, visto che comunque puoi ottenere lo stesso risultato anche con Enterprise Manager... nel dialogo di gestione dell'oggetto tabella puoi infatti procedere a salvare lo script di modifica.. e quindi utilizzare tale script per propagare le modifiche..
saluti

Andrea Montanari
http://www.hotelsole.com - http://www.hotelsole.com/asql/index.php
2.410 messaggi dal 13 febbraio 2003
Contributi
no a patto di non scaricare SSMS versione Express che è gratuita e scaricabile dal sito microsoft.com oppure acquistare sql compare di red-gate
1.024 messaggi dal 19 dicembre 2003
Contributi | Blog
clockdva ha scritto:
uso sql server (non ricordo la versione perchè ora sono a casa, comunque è recente)


Tanto recente non è visto che usi Enterprise Manager.
La versione "recente" di SQL Server è la 2005 ma non puoi utilizzare con questa versione EM, ergo stai lavorando con SQL Server 2000.
Chiacchiere a parte, anche con EM puoi salvare gli script delle modifiche che apporti alla struttura dati. Quando apri in design mode una tabella e aggiungi un campo, modifichi un datatype, ecc, hai la possibilità di salvare su file i comandi che EM esegue dietro le quinte. Guarda in alto vicino al pulsante "Salva" e trovi un pulsante "Script file" (o qualcosa di simile... è tanto che non uso EM...)

Bye

Torna al forum | Feed RSS

ASPItalia.com non è responsabile per il contenuto dei messaggi presenti su questo servizio, non avendo nessun controllo sui messaggi postati nei propri forum, che rappresentano l'espressione del pensiero degli autori.